China's steel exports increase in May

According to data from China's customs, in May, China's steel exports totaled about 9.63 million tons, increasing by 4.4% or 407,000 tons from the previous month.

Meanwhile, steel imports decreased by 3.2% or 21,000 tons month on month to about 637,000 tons.

In the first five months, China exported steel with 44.65 million tons, increasing by 24.7% from the same period last year.

Besides, the imports totaled 3.043 million tons, a year-on-year decrease of 2.7%.
